Yi Sun-Sin Park in Tongyeong-si is a serene memorial park dedicated to the legendary Korean naval commander, Admiral Yi Sun-sin. Nestled amidst picturesque landscapes, the park offers tourists a tranquil escape, celebrating history and natural beauty.

Getting There
-
Car
If you're driving from Busan, take the Gyeongbu Expressway (Route 1) towards Tongyeong. From Route 1, take the exit for Tongyeong (Exit 27). Continue on Tongyeong's main road (Mendehaean-gil) for about 10 kilometers until you reach Yi Sun-Sin Park at 205 Mendehaean-gil, Tongyeong-si, Gyeongsangnam-do. Parking is available near the park but may incur a fee of approximately 1,000 KRW per hour.
-
Public Transportation
From Busan, take a bus from Busan Central Bus Terminal to Tongyeong. The bus ride will take about 1.5 to 2 hours. Once you arrive at Tongyeong Bus Terminal, take local bus number 100 or 101, which will take you directly to Yi Sun-Sin Park. The bus fare is around 1,200 KRW. Be sure to check the bus schedules as they may vary throughout the day.
-
Taxi
If you prefer a more direct route, you can take a taxi from Tongyeong Bus Terminal to Yi Sun-Sin Park. The taxi ride will take around 10 minutes and cost approximately 5,000 to 7,000 KRW, depending on traffic.
